Cisco ATA 187 Analog Telephone Adaptor
Overview
This section describes the hardware and software features of the Cisco ATA 187 Analog Telephone
Adaptor (ATA 187) and includes a brief overview of the Session Initiation Protocol (SIP).
The ATA 187 analog telephone adaptors are handset-to-Ethernet adaptors that allow regular analog
phones to operate on IP-based telephony networks. The ATA 187 support two voice ports, each with an
independent phone number. The ATA 187 also has an RJ-45 10/100BASE-T data port.
